Premier League: Cristiano Ronaldo nets winner against Everton; scores 700th club goal of his career

Xtra Time Web Desk: Manchester United star Cristiano Ronaldo finally overcame his goal drought as he netted the winner against Everton in Premier League match on Sunday. It was also the 700th club goal for the Portugese superstar.

It was Ronaldo’s 144th goal for Red Devils across two spells at the Old Trafford. The talisman has also netted five goals for Sporting Lisbon,101 goals for Juventus and 450 for Real Madrid.

As far as the match goes, Everton took the lead at Goodison Park after Alex Iwobi curled a sublime strike into the net from 20 metres. United restored parity with Brazilian Antony scoring the equalizer.

The visitors suffered a setback as Anthony Martial had to be withdrawn in the 29th minute after he picked a back injury. Ronaldo, who came in as a substitute was on the scoresheet. The 37-year-old Portugal striker latched onto a through-ball from Casemiro and slotted it at the back of the nets past Everton goalkeeper Jordan Pickford in the 44th minute.
